Obituary for Mary Elizabeth Gilchrist (McLaren)

GILCHRIST, Mary Elizabeth - Passed away peacefully at Upper Canada Lodge at the age of 96. Beloved wife and predeceased by husband Norman; Cherished mother of Alan (Elaine), David (Claudia) and Iain (who died in infancy). Mary will also be sadly missed by grandchildren Christopher (Megan) and Andrew (Jodi). She was absolutely delighted by the arrival of great-grandchildren Hannah, Arabella, Elise and Lachlan. She is survived by brother John (June) and Ella (her older sister). and was predeceased by siblings Robert, George and Catharine.
Mary was born in 1926 in Cruickness (Inverkeithing) on the banks of the Firth of Forth opposite Edinburgh in which city she resided for much of her young life. She always liked to mention that she attended the same school as Sean Connery (although not at the same time she would quickly add). Following her marriage to Norman and the loss of her baby, Iain, the family immigrated to Canada in 1958. She was instrumental in helping her family navigate difficult circumstances when shortly following her arrival with her two sons in Canada, Norm's employment ended with the shocking cancellation of the Avro Arrow project. She also was devoted totally to her husband's care when he later developed an extreme form of rheumatoid arthritis. She was a modest and unassuming yet truly powerful symbol of courage in coping with the challenges which can occur in life.
Mary will be remembered by all who were privileged to meet her as a courageous, kind, considerate and loving lady. She greatly respected the rights and views of others and was always open to putting the interests of others before her own.
